Aberdour Festival
Date Location
The picturesque seaside town plays host to an action-packed family-friendly festival. There's something for all ages and all tastes, from a beach day with a sandcastle competition for children and raft race for adults, to food and wine tastings with twinned towns in Italy and France, as well as sports, magic shows, children's activities and live music over the course of ten days.

Royal Observatory Greenwich
Date Location
The home of time where you can find out about the stars and stand on the Greenwich Meridian line and learn about navigation. Explore the redeveloped galleries, planetarium and education centre, with special events and activities taking place throughout the year.
